Gulf Shores, Alabama

Gulf Shores, Alabama

Gulf Shores, Alabama is one the best places to travel in summer. If you're looking for summer vacation ideas, with 32 miles of white sandy beaches, Gulf Shores is a hidden gem in the southern United States. In addition to beach activities like swimming, sunbathing, and building sandcastles, visitors can also enjoy fishing, boating, and hiking in the nearby Gulf State Park. There are plenty of affordable lodging options, from camping to vacation rentals, and the local cuisine is both delicious and budget-friendly.

For beach lovers, the Gulf Shores, Alabama is one of the best summer holiday destinations, with its pristine white sand beaches and crystal clear waters. Gulf Shores is a perfect combination of sun, sand, and savings for your summer travel. With 32 miles of white sandy beaches and clear blue waters, it's no wonder that Gulf Shores is becoming an increasingly popular beach destination. But what sets Gulf Shores apart is the abundance of affordable activities and accommodations.

Beach activities are the main draw in Gulf Shores, and there are plenty of them to enjoy. Visitors can swim, sunbathe, and build sandcastles on the pristine beaches. For those who want to venture out into the water, there are options for kayaking, paddleboarding, and even parasailing. And of course, fishing is a popular activity in Gulf Shores, with plenty of opportunities for both saltwater and freshwater fishing.

But there's more to Gulf Shores than just the beach. Gulf State Park offers hiking trails, fishing piers, and even a zip line course. The Gulf Coast Zoo, which has recently moved to a new location, is a great place to see exotic animals up close. And for history buffs, Fort Morgan is a must-visit site, with its well-preserved fortifications and stunning views of Mobile Bay.

Accommodations in Gulf Shores range from camping to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of affordable options to choose from. The local cuisine is both delicious and budget-friendly, with plenty of seafood restaurants and local shops to explore. Overall, Gulf Shores is a great choice for families on a budget who want to experience the best of the Gulf Coast.

Myrtle Beach, South Carolina

Myrtle Beach, South Carolina

Myrtle Beach is a classic beach destination that has been attracting visitors for generations. With 60 miles of white sandy beaches, beachfront hotels, and affordable family-friendly attractions, it's easy to see why Myrtle Beach is a favorite among families.

The beach is the main draw in Myrtle Beach, and there are plenty of activities to enjoy. Visitors can swim, sunbathe, and build sandcastles on the wide, flat beach. For those who want to venture out into the water, there are options for kayaking, parasailing, and even surfing. But Myrtle Beach isn't just about the beach - there are plenty of other activities to keep visitors entertained.

One of the top attractions in Myrtle Beach is Broadway at the Beach, a 350-acre shopping, dining, and entertainment complex. Visitors can shop at the many stores, enjoy a meal at one of the many restaurants, or take in a show at the Carolina Opry or Legends in Concert. There are also plenty of affordable family-friendly attractions in Myrtle Beach, like mini-golf courses, amusement parks, and water parks.

Accommodations in Myrtle Beach range from budget-friendly hotels to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of options to choose from. The local cuisine is also affordable and delicious, with plenty of seafood restaurants and local eateries to try. Overall, Myrtle Beach is a great choice for families on a budget who want to experience the classic beach vacation.

Outer Banks, North Carolina

Outer Banks, North Carolina

The Outer Banks is a string of barrier islands off the coast of North Carolina that offers a laid-back atmosphere and stunning natural beauty. With miles of pristine beaches, historic lighthouses, and natural preserves, the Outer Banks is a must-visit destination for families on a budget.

The beaches are the main draw in the Outer Banks, and there are plenty of activities to enjoy. Visitors can swim, sunbathe, and go fishing on the many beaches, including the famous Cape Hatteras National Seashore. For those who want to explore the natural beauty of the area, there are options for kayaking, hiking, and even hang gliding. And history buffs will appreciate the many historic sites, including the Wright Brothers National Memorial, where visitors can learn about the first flight made by the Wright Brothers.

Accommodations in the Outer Banks range from campgrounds to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of affordable options to choose from. The local cuisine is also delicious and budget-friendly, with plenty of seafood restaurants and local shops to explore. Overall, the Outer Banks is a great choice for families who want to experience the natural beauty and history of the East Coast without breaking the bank.

Yosemite National Park, California

Yosemite National Park, California

Yosemite National Park is one of the most breathtaking natural wonders in the United States. Located in the Sierra Nevada Mountains of California, the park offers stunning scenery, incredible wildlife, and endless opportunities for outdoor adventure. For outdoor enthusiasts, summer travel destinations like Yosemite National Park in the United States offer breathtaking scenery and hiking opportunities.

One of the most popular activities in Yosemite is hiking. The park has over 800 miles of trails, ranging from easy strolls to strenuous hikes. Some of the most iconic hikes include Half Dome, Yosemite Falls, and the Mist Trail. And for families with young children, the nature walks and Junior Ranger programs offer a fun and educational experience. Another popular activity in Yosemite is rock climbing. The park has over 3,000 climbing routes, ranging from beginner to expert level. And for those who prefer water activities, there are opportunities for rafting and kayaking in the park's rivers and lakes.

Accommodations in Yosemite range from campsites to hotels, and there are options to fit every budget. And for those who prefer to cook their own meals, there are plenty of affordable options for grocery shopping in the nearby towns.

Overall, Yosemite National Park is a must-visit destination for families who love the outdoors. With stunning scenery, endless opportunities for adventure, and affordable accommodations, Yosemite is the perfect summer vacation destination.

Acadia National Park, Maine

Acadia National Park, Maine

Acadia National Park is located on the rugged coast of Maine and offers a unique blend of natural beauty and cultural history. With over 47,000 acres of land, the park features stunning ocean vistas, towering mountains, and pristine lakes.

One of the most popular activities in Acadia is hiking. With over 120 miles of trails, there are options for hikers of all levels. The Cadillac Mountain Summit Trail is a must-do for visitors, offering st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ean and surrounding islands. Families with young children will love the easy and scenic Ocean Path Trail, which follows the coastline.

Another popular activity in Acadia is biking. The park has over 45 miles of carriage roads that were originally built by John D. Rockefeller Jr. for horse-drawn carriages. Today, the roads are popular with bikers and offer stunning views of the park's natural beauty. In addition to outdoor activities, Acadia also offers opportunities for cultural exploration. Visitors can explore historic sites like the Jordan Pond House, a historic restaurant and tea house, and the Schoodic Institute, a research and education center.

Accommodations in Acadia range from campsites to hotels, and there are options to fit every budget. And for those who prefer to cook their own meals, there are plenty of affordable options for grocery shopping in nearby towns. Acadia National Park is a perfect summer vacation destination for families who love the outdoors and are interested in history and culture. With stunning scenery, endless opportunities for adventure, and affordable accommodations, Acadia is a must-visit destination.

Great Smoky Mountains National Park, Tennessee/North Carolina

Great Smoky Mountains National Park, Tennessee/North Carolina

Great Smoky Mountains National Park is a stunning mountainous region that straddles the border of Tennessee and North Carolina. The park offers a unique blend of natural beauty and cultural history, with over 800 miles of hiking trails, scenic drives, and historic sites.

One of the most popular activities in the park is hiking. The Great Smoky Mountains offer over 800 miles of hiking trails, ranging from easy strolls to strenuous hikes. Some of the most popular hikes include the Alum Cave Trail, the Appalachian Trail, and the Chimney Tops Trail.

Another popular activity in the park is wildlife viewing. The Great Smoky Mountains are home to a diverse range of wildlife, including black bears, deer, elk, and over 200 species of birds. Visitors can take guided tours or explore the park on their own to spot wildlife. In addition to outdoor activities, the park also offers opportunities for cultural exploration. Visitors can explore historic sites like the Mountain Farm Museum and Mingus Mill, which showcase the region's pioneer history.

Accommodations in the Great Smoky Mountains range from campsites to hotels, and there are options to fit every budget. And for those who prefer to cook their own meals, there are plenty of affordable options for grocery shopping in nearby towns. Nashville, Tennessee

Nashville, Tennessee

If you're looking for a city break, summer travel destinations like New York, Nashville Tennessee offer endless entertainment and cultural experiences. Nashville, also known as Music City, is a vibrant and budget-friendly city escape that is perfect for a summer vacation. With a rich music scene, delicious Southern cuisine, and plenty of affordable attractions, Nashville has something to offer for everyone.

For those who are interested in history, visiting a historic site or museum can be a fascinating and educational way to spend a summer vacation. Many of these destinations offer tours and special events during the summer months. One of the most popular attractions in Nashville is the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um. The museum showcases the history of country music and features exhibits on legendary musicians like Johnny Cash and Dolly Parton. Admission prices are reasonable, and the museum also offers free concerts and events throughout the year. Another must-visit attraction in Nashville is the Ryman Auditorium, also known as the "Mother Church of Country Music." The historic venue has hosted legendary musicians like Hank Williams and Patsy Cline, and visitors can take guided tours to learn about its rich history. In addition to music, Nashville is also known for its delicious Southern cuisine. Visitors can sample local favorites like hot chicken and biscuits at affordable restaurants like Hattie B's and Loveless Cafe.

For those who love the outdoors, Nashville also has plenty of parks and green spaces to explore. The Centennial Park is a popular destination for picnics and concerts, and the Radnor Lake State Park offers hiking trails and wildlife viewing opportunities.

Accommodations in Nashville range from budget-friendly hotels to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of options to fit every budget. And for those who love to shop, Nashville has a thriving local arts and crafts scene, with plenty of affordable shops and markets to explore. Nashville is a budget-friendly city escape that offers a unique blend of music, history, and Southern charm. With affordable attractions and accommodations, it's the perfect summer vacation destination for families and music lovers alike.

New Orleans, Louisiana

New Orleans, Louisiana

New Orleans, also known as the Big Easy, is a vibrant and budget-friendly city escape that is perfect for a summer vacation. With a rich cultural history, delicious Creole cuisine, and plenty of affordable attractions, New Orleans has something to offer for everyone.

One of the most popular attractions in New Orleans is the French Quarter, a historic neighborhood that is home to colorful buildings, live music, and delicious food. Visitors can take free walking tours to learn about the history of the area, or explore on their own and sample local favorites like beignets and gumbo. Another must-visit attraction in New Orleans is the National World War II Museum. The museum showcases the history of the war and features exhibits on the European and Pacific theaters, as well as the home front. Admission prices are reasonable, and the museum also offers free concerts and events throughout the year.

In addition to history and food, New Orleans is also known for its vibrant music scene. Visitors can enjoy free live music at venues like Preservation Hall, or take a jazz brunch cruise on the Mississippi River. For those who love the outdoors, New Orleans also has plenty of parks and green spaces to explore. The City Park is a popular destination for picnics and concerts, and the Audubon Park offers hiking trails and wildlife viewing opportunities.

Accommodations in New Orleans range from budget-friendly hotels to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of options to fit every budget. And for those who love to shop, New Orleans has a thriving local arts and crafts scene, with plenty of affordable shops and markets to explore. New Orleans is a budget-friendly city escape that offers a unique blend of history, culture, and delicious cuisine. With affordable attractions and accommodations, it's the perfect summer vacation destination for families and music lovers alike.

San Antonio, Texas

San Antonio, Texas

San Antonio, known for its rich history and iconic River Walk, is a budget-friendly city escape that has something for everyone. From museums to outdoor activities, there are plenty of affordable ways to enjoy this vibrant city.

One of the top attractions in San Antonio is the Alamo, the historic site where Texan soldiers fought for independence in 1836. Admission to the Alamo is free, and visitors can take self-guided tours to learn about the history of the site.

Another must-visit attraction in San Antonio is the River Walk, a scenic pathway along the San Antonio River that is lined with restaurants, shops, and attractions. Visitors can take a riverboat tour to learn about the history of the area, or simply enjoy a leisurely walk along the water.

For those interested in history, San Antonio also has several museums that offer free admission, including the San Antonio Museum of Art and the Institute of Texan Cultures. The McNay Art Museum also offers free admission on Thursdays, and the Witte Museum offers free admission on Tuesdays. For outdoor enthusiasts, San Antonio has several parks and green spaces to explore, including Brackenridge Park and the Japanese Tea Garden. And for families, the San Antonio Zoo and the Children's Museum are both affordable and fun attractions.

Accommodations in San Antonio range from budget-friendly hotels to vacation rentals, and there are plenty of options to fit every budget. And for those looking for a budget-friendly meal, San Antonio is known for its delicious Tex-Mex cuisine, with plenty of affordable restaurants and food trucks to choose from. San Antonio is a budget-friendly city escape that offers a unique blend of history, culture, and outdoor activities. With affordable attractions and accommodations, it's the perfect summer vacation destination for families and history buffs alike.

Pacific Coast Highway, California

Pacific Coast Highway, California

The Pacific Coast Highway, also known as California State Route 1, is one of the most scenic drives in the United States, offering breathtaking views of the California coastline. This iconic route stretches over 650 miles from San Francisco in the north to San Diego in the south, passing through charming coastal towns and offering opportunities for outdoor activities and sightseeing.

Pacific Coast Highway, California road trip can be a great option for affordable summer vacations, allowing you to explore new destinations while saving on airfare and accommodations. Along the way, visitors can stop at landmarks such as the Golden Gate Bridge, the Monterey Bay Aquarium, and the Santa Barbara Mission. They can also explore the stunning Big Sur region, home to rugged cliffs, hidden coves, and scenic hiking trails.

How far in advance should I book my summer vacation?

The best time to book a summer vacation largely depends on your destination, travel dates, and personal preferences. Generally speaking, it's a good idea to start planning and booking your summer vacation at least 3-6 months in advance to ensure you get the best deals on flights, accommodations, and activities.

If you're planning to travel during peak summer vacation season, which is typically June through August in many countries, it's recommended to book even earlier, as popular destinations tend to fill up quickly and prices can rise significantly.

However, if you have more flexibility in your travel plans or are willing to take a more spontaneous approach, you can sometimes find last-minute deals on flights and accommodations by booking within 1-2 weeks of your desired travel dates. This strategy works best for off-season or less popular destinations.

In any case, it's always a good idea to do your research and compare prices and options from different airlines, hotels, and travel agencies to ensure you're getting the best value for your money. Additionally, consider booking travel insurance to protect your investment in case of unexpected events or emergencies.

What are some ways to save money on a summer vacation?

To save money on a summer vacation, consider traveling during the shoulder season, packing snacks and cooking meals instead of eating out, and opting for free or low-cost activities like hiking, visiting local markets, or attending community events. Here're some tips to save money on a summer vacation;

  • Travel during off-peak season: Traveling during off-peak season can be a great way to save money on flights, accommodations, and activities. Prices tend to be lower and there are fewer crowds, allowing you to enjoy a more relaxed and budget-friendly vacation.
  • Choose budget-friendly destinations: Consider choosing budget-friendly destinations that offer plenty of activities and attractions at a lower cost. Look for destinations that offer free or low-cost activities such as parks, beaches, and museums.
  • Stay in vacation rentals or hostels: Instead of booking expensive hotels, consider staying in vacation rentals, hostels, or camping sites. These options are often much more affordable and can provide a unique and memorable vacation experience.
  • Use travel rewards or loyalty programs: Take advantage of travel rewards or loyalty programs offered by airlines, hotels, and credit cards. This can help you earn points or miles that can be redeemed for free flights, accommodations, or other travel expenses.
  • Book in advance and compare prices: Book your flights, accommodations, and activities in advance to take advantage of early-bird deals and discounts. Additionally, compare prices from different airlines, hotels, and travel agencies to ensure you're getting the best value for your money.
  • Cook your own meals: Eating out can be one of the biggest expenses during a vacation. Consider cooking your own meals by renting a vacation rental with a kitchen or packing a picnic to enjoy at a local park or beach.
  • Look for free activities: Many destinations offer free or low-cost activities such as hiking, swimming, and visiting local markets. Do some research in advance to find these activities and plan your itinerary accordingly.

What are some safety tips for traveling during the summer?

To stay safe while traveling during the summer, make sure to wear sunscreen, stay hydrated, pack a first-aid kit, and research the local weather and natural hazards in the area. Here're some crucial things to consider during your summer travel;

  1. Be aware of the weather: Depending on your destination, summer weather can be extreme, with high temperatures, humidity, and the potential for thunderstorms or hurricanes. Be sure to check the weather forecast regularly and pack appropriate clothing and gear.
  2. Stay hydrated: When traveling during the summer, it's important to stay hydrated, especially in hot and humid climates. Drink plenty of water and avoid alcohol and caffeine, which can dehydrate you.
  3. Protect yourself from the sun: Sun exposure can cause sunburn, dehydration, and even skin cancer. Wear sunscreen with at least SPF 30, a hat, and sunglasses when spending time outdoors. Try to stay in the shade during peak sun hours.
  4. Practice good hygiene: Traveling during the summer can increase your risk of getting sick, so it's important to practice good hygiene. Wash your hands regularly, avoid touching your face, and carry hand sanitizer.
  5. Be cautious around water: If you plan to swim, boat, or participate in other water activities, be sure to follow safety guidelines and wear a life jacket if necessary. Be cautious of strong currents, rip tides, and other water hazards.
  6. Secure your belongings: Summer is a popular time for tourists, which means pickpocketing and theft can be more common. Keep your belongings secure and avoid carrying large amounts of cash or valuables.
  7. Research your destination: Before traveling, research your destination and familiarize yourself with local customs, laws, and potential safety hazards. Register with your embassy or consulate in case of emergency.

By following these safety tips, you can enjoy a safe and enjoyable summer vacation.

How can I stay eco-friendly while on a summer vacation?

To stay eco-friendly while on a summer vacation, choose accommodations that prioritize sustainability, avoid single-use plastics, and opt for public transportation or biking instead of driving. It's also important to respect local wildlife and natural habitats by following Leave No Trace principles. Here're some tips to stay eco-friendly during your summer vacation.

  • Choose eco-friendly accommodations: Look for hotels and accommodations that have eco-friendly practices such as using renewable energy, recycling, and reducing water usage.
  • Reduce plastic usage: Bring a reusable water bottle and coffee cup, and avoid using single-use plastic items such as straws, utensils, and shopping bags. If you must use plastic, be sure to properly dispose of it in recycling bins.
  • Use public transportation: Consider using public transportation or walking/biking instead of renting a car or taking taxis. This can help reduce carbon emissions and save money.
  • Support local businesses: Support local businesses and buy locally-sourced products, which can help reduce carbon emissions from transportation and support the local economy.
  • Conserve water and electricity: Be mindful of water and electricity usage by turning off lights and air conditioning when leaving the room and taking short showers.
  • Leave no trace: When hiking or exploring nature, be sure to follow the "Leave No Trace" principles by properly disposing of waste and avoiding disturbing wildlife or plants.
  • Volunteer for eco-friendly activities: Consider volunteering for activities such as beach cleanups or habitat restoration projects, which can help protect the environment and connect with the local community.

By following these tips, you can enjoy a summer vacation while reducing your impact on the environment.
